Starbucks is a roaster, marketer and retailer of coffee. Co. purchases and roasts coffees that it sells, along with handcrafted coffee, tea and other beverages and a variety of food items, through company-operated stores. Co. also sells a variety of coffee and tea products and licenses its trademarks via other channels such as licensed stores, grocery and national foodservice accounts. In addition to its Starbucks brand, Co.'s portfolio also includes brands such as Seattle's Best Coffee®. Co. has four segments: Americas; Europe, Middle East, and Africa; and China/Asia Pacific; and Channel Development. At Sep 30 2012, Co. had 9,405 company-operated retail stores and 8,661 licensed stores.
